And pulling back from my own (reasonably subtle) issues for a moment, could e-counselling be the answer to the mental health problems escalating amongst under-30s? With cuts to psychological health services actually starting to bite, digitised therapy could be just the ticket for young people who currently filter nearly every element of their lives– buddies, work, sex, entertainment– through a screen.
“You get to know not only what it’s like to talk to the person, but how it feels to be in a space with them. Using Skype is the next best thing: it’s ‘good enough’, however it doesn’t create the nearness, the intimacy, that truly gets individuals to open up and explore things.”.
” I have actually performed some research into Skype counselling,” says London-based psychotherapist Dr Aaron Balick, “and it’s not the ‘functional equivalent’ of standard counselling; it’s just not quite the very same thing. It’s really crucial that individuals who take part in it are aware that it’s a various experience from remaining in the space with someone, speaking face-to-face.” Doctor On Demand Vs Talkspace
